Sample Type
Serum, plasma, tissue homogenates
Intended Use
For the quantitative determination of human platelet-derived growth factor-BB (PDGF-BB) concentrations in serum, plasma and tissue homogenates.
Specificity
This assay has high sensitivity and excellent specificity for detection of human PDGF-BB. No significant cross-reactivity or interference between human PDGF-BB and analogues was observed.
Test Principle
This BioAssay™ employs the quantitative sandwich enzyme immunoassay technique. Antibody specific for PDGF-BB has been pre-coated onto a microplate. Standards and samples are pipetted into the wells and any PDGF-BB present is bound by the immobilized antibody. After removing any unbound substances, a biotin-conjugated antibody specific for PDGF-BB is added to the wells. After washing, avidin conjugated Horseradish Peroxidase (HRP) is added to the wells. Following a wash to remove any unbound avidin-enzyme reagent, a substrate solution is added to the wells and color develops in proportion to the amount of PDGF-BB bound in the initial step. The color development is stopped and the intensity of the color is measured.
